Exemplo n.º 1
0
 public void Remover(int idProduto)
 {
     var itemNoCarrinho = Itens.FirstOrDefault(item => item.Produto.Id == idProduto);
     if (itemNoCarrinho != null)
     {
         itens.Remove(itemNoCarrinho);
     }
 }
Exemplo n.º 2
0
        public void Adicionar(Produto produto, int quantidade)
        {
            var itemNoCarrinho = Itens.FirstOrDefault(item => item.Produto.Id == produto.Id);

            if (itemNoCarrinho == null)
            {
                var item = new ItemCarrinho(produto, quantidade);
                Itens.Add(item);
            }
            else
            {
                itemNoCarrinho.Quantidade += quantidade;
            }
        }
Exemplo n.º 3
0
    public void IniciarJogadaGame()
    {
        InputField.Select();

        InputField.ActivateInputField();

        currentItem = Itens.FirstOrDefault() ?? null;

        txtResposta.text = "Ver Resposta";

        respostaRevelada = false;

        if (currentItem != null)
        {
            button.image.sprite = currentItem.Imagem;

            TextDinamico.text = currentItem.Nome;
        }
    }
 internal CarrinhoItem ObterPorProdutoId(Guid produtoId)
 {
     return(Itens.FirstOrDefault(p => p.ProdutoId == produtoId));
 }
Exemplo n.º 5
0
 internal ItemCart GetItemByIdProduct(Guid idProduct)
 {
     return(Itens.FirstOrDefault(p => p.IdProduct == idProduct));
 }
 internal TermoTransferenciaItem ObterPorPatrimonioId(Guid patrimonioId)
 {
     return(Itens.FirstOrDefault(p => p.PatrimonioId == patrimonioId));
 }